Upwork logo

Automation / AI Full stack developer (Python + React) - Build Internal AI Plattform

Upwork

We are building an internal platform that automates the creation and management of employer branding profiles across platforms like kununu, Glassdoor, LinkedIn, and Indeed.

The system will

  • collect company data from websites and public sources
  • generate employer branding content using AI
  • store and manage data in a structured database
  • provide a dashboard for our operations team
  • automate repetitive workflows where possible

We are looking for a hands-on full-stack developer who can build this MVP system from scratch.

This is a practical product role focused on automation, AI integration, and internal tooling, not just frontend work.

Main Responsibilities

Build the first version of our platform including:

  • backend API and database
  • company data collection pipeline
  • AI content generation pipeline
  • internal operations dashboard
  • automation tools for repetitive workflows

Required Skills

Strong experience with

Backend

  • Python
  • FastAPI or similar framework
  • REST API development

Frontend

  • React or Next.js
  • building dashboards or internal tools

Database

  • PostgreSQL

Automation

  • Playwright / Selenium / Puppeteer

AI Integration

  • experience working with LLM APIs (OpenAI or similar)

Infrastructure

  • AWS or similar cloud platforms
  • Docker preferred

Ideal Candidate

You are someone who

  • has 5+ years development experience
  • enjoys building systems from scratch
  • understands automation pipelines
  • has built SaaS tools or internal platforms before
  • can work independently and propose architecture

Project Scope

Initial MVP build

  • architecture setup
  • data ingestion pipeline
  • AI content generation pipeline
  • internal dashboard

Estimated timeline: 4–8 weeks for first version

Important

Please include in your proposal

Links to projects you built end-to-end and describe what tools you used and how you did it.

Also, tell us about your experience with automation or scraping systems

and a short explanation of how you would architect this system.

This project could become a longer term project and cooperation (3-12 months +) if we are successful. Thank you

Job Type

Job Type
Contract
Location
United States

Share this job: